EC books case against INTUC for violation of poll code of conduct in Sastan

Udupi: The Election Commission has registered a case of violation of poll code of conduct which was reported in the Congress INTUC office Sastan under the Kota police station limits on Friday, March 30.

According to the police, the accused Sathish Poojary and Sharath, members of INTUC were campaigning for Congress in the INTUC office they were filling the forms of applicants for various insurance schemes. The pamphlets and posters in the office were carrying photographs of Chief Minister Siddaramaiah, Minister Santhosh Lad and the State INTUC president and also Kundapur Assembly constituency Congress ticket aspirant Rakesh Malli. They were pamphlets and posters carrying the messages of campaigning in the office.

Kota police have lodged an FIR under IPC Sections 171 C, 171 F and 127 A of the RP Act.
